Installation note for the new ACR:

After running the installer and launching the updated ADR to check on the glow tool (which worked fine), the AI Denoise feature was not working. In magnified views there was a ton of noise in raw files, and turning AI Denoise on/off and/or adjusting the amount (unlabeled) fader beneath the AI Denoise checkbox had no effect.

The noise actually looked worse than I would normally see in a file with no NR applied.

The solution was to reboot the computer. (Mac OS running most recent system updates.) After that the Denoise feature worked correctly again.

Recently I have encountered at least one other situation where I had to reboot the computer after doing an Adobe update to eliminate odd little issues sort of like this.

Yeah, the “negative dehaze” and “negative clarity” tricks seem to be overlooked by a lot of folks. I think it is because we think of those tools as being there to _increase_ clarity and “increase dehaze” (aka reduce haze) and it never occurs to people that there are situations when the tools can be usefully applied to soften images as well.

BTW, I ran into another oddball glitch with this update. I had edited a file somewhat heavily in ACR right before updating. I reopened it after finishing that process, and clicking the button at the lower left that should open it as a smart object in Photoshop no longer worked. It looked like ACR was starting to do the process, but the file never opened in Photoshop.

I went through the restart routine again and even signed out of and back into the Creative Cloud. Still no go. Then I thought to open a different raw file by double clicking it in Bridge to open in ACR, then hitting that export button again. It worked for this “virgin” raw file.

I went back to my edited file in ACR and chose the option that sets everything back to import defaults… and now it would open in PS.

Odd. And that’s a new one to me.
